My point was you can only get Empyrean in 6 packs in Omaha. This post was about an Omaha bar the Brass Monkey. I live in Omaha and should have stated Omaha not the entire state. I have spoke with Trevor from Thunderhead and he didn't know when he will be selling in Omaha. As far as hand canning. I would think the cost is in Thunderhead's favor. I thought Trevor does it himself so no labor and no packaging other than the can and 6 pack ring. Empyrean uses at least 2-4 hourly employees, bottles cost more than cans since they need glass bottles, label, crowns, and six pack carries. Lucky Bucket is still planning on package beer but they don't have an exact date yet. They have kept pushing back a release date. So Empyrean is the only Nebraska brewed beer in Omaha available in 6 pack right now. Empyrean sells all over the state also. Thunderhead I think is only available in Kearney, Hastings, Grand Island, and Lincoln communities. Lucky Bucket will only be in Omaha, Lincoln, and north of Elkhorn to Norkfolk.
